539580
000000000000000000130809bdf0e895c7c660626b67a64971353e580a9a5713
Time
09-02-2018 09:58:59 (Local)
Sponsored
Transaction Fees
0.00572135
BTC
Confirmations
368012
Total Amounts
549620.3296302 USDT
Transaction Counts
37
Previous Block:
Merkle Root:
68f0ccd0de95ab171d9de444d2e6618b530bc0da0e814545d39dafc2d01a5fd3